About The Position

This procurement position plays a critical role within Pratt & Whitney’s Supply Chain organization, supporting procurement activities that enable uninterrupted manufacturing and site operations. This position is responsible for the execution of sourcing strategies, supplier management, and purchase order management for indirect goods and outside services. This role partners closely with internal stakeholders and suppliers to ensure cost-effective, compliant, and timely procurement of materials and services that support operational performance.

Responsibilities

  • Execute sourcing and procurement activities for indirect materials and services (MRO, consumables, services, capital support, etc.)
  • Support RFQs, bid evaluations, and supplier selection in alignment with site-level strategies
  • Prepare and manage purchase orders, ensuring accuracy in pricing, lead times, and terms & conditions
  • Assist in contract execution and supplier onboarding processes
  • Identify opportunities for cost savings and process efficiencies
  • Operate with a high degree of autonomy to manage indirect and outside services categories, making sound and compliant procurement decisions to support business objectives
  • Monitor supplier performance including on-time delivery (OTD), responsiveness, and quality
  • Coordinate with suppliers to resolve delivery issues, shortages, and invoice discrepancies
  • Support supplier communications and maintain strong working relationships
  • Ensure timely placement and follow-up of purchase orders to support site operations
  • Partner with Materials Planning and internal stakeholders to align supply with demand
  • Proactively identify and escalate supply risks or constraints impacting operations
  • Collaborate with Operations, Finance, Quality, Engineering, and EHS teams to support procurement needs
  • Ensure compliance with company policies, AS9100 requirements, and procurement procedures
  • Support new product introduction (NPI), site projects, and operational initiatives as needed
  • Maintain accurate procurement data within SAP and/or Ariba systems
  • Analyze purchasing data to support decision-making and performance improvement
  • Support audit readiness and documentation compliance
